The apartments are in Casteldilago, a medieval village in the Arrone municipality, situated in the heart of the Nera River park, a natural protected area with an extraordinary and significant landscape, 6km from the Marmore Falls. It is an ideal point to set off for excursions and various sporting activities.
Casteldilago, situated on a rocky spur, has clearly maintained the characteristics of a medieval castle.
Its name is taken from the lake which in ancient times surrounded the area.
Its population was steadily and autonomously administered until 1817, whereafter it joined the Arrone municipality.

The Valnerina (or Little Valley of the River Nera), in Southern Umbria, is situated in an almost untouched natural environment characterized by the flowing Nera River and since 1995, it forms part of the natural parks system of the Umbria region, named “Nera River Park”.
The territory is dominated by green woods, hills and the valley and is abounding in water, having thick vegetation which in some parts forms a green passageway by the water. Excellent spots include Piediluco Lake and Marmore Falls which offer landscapes of rare beauty and charm.

The Valnerina offers unforgettable landscape views and is characteristic due to the series of charming little towns and medieval style fortresses high up amidst the rocky verdant hills, descending until they dip down in the fresh and clear water of the river.

Art and history lovers can visit ancient, partly restored, medieval villages and castles, monuments, churches, abbeys and convents that bears witness to important works of art of famous Umbrian painters (Siculian Jacopo, Giovanni di Pietro also known as “lo Spagna”), which forms a real widespread museum in the area.
